You add the new account thru Outlook Express, *NOT* thru the eternal-
september.org website. Of course you're already a client. You're a
motzarella client.
Do this: (in OUTLOOK EXPRESS)
1. Tools > Accounts > News
2. click ADD
3. selects "news" from the dropdown menu
-fill in your display name, hit NEXT
-fill in your email address, hit NEXT
-type in news.eternal-september.org, (do *not* hit next yet)
-CHECK "my news server requires me to log on", hit NEXT
-type in your account name and password
-CHECK remember password
-do NOT check the Secure password authenication box, now hit NEXT
- click FINISH
You should then get a message that asks "would you like to download
newsgroups from the news account you added?
click YES
You may get a prompt to enter your username and password -- do so.
